Virtualize both, your backed up physical machines and VMware servers on the BMR server without any additional hardware or hypervisor requirement. In case your machines are no longer accessible due to any disaster or a ransomware attack, use a recovery point created before the attack to create a virtual instance. This makes BMR instant virtualization an effective Disaster Recovery as a Service (DRaaS) solution, achieving high availability of machines.

BMR instant virtualization allows a protected system to be virtualized and hosted locally

Creating a virtual machine:

You can create up to four virtual instances of your backed up physical machines and VMware servers

  • In the Local Virtualization section, select the required client, choose the recovery points for the given volumes, and the number of processors for the virtual machine. Enter the memory value in the Memory field

    Choose specifications to build virtual machine

    Create the virtual machine by selecting the required client, recovery points for the given volumes, number of processors for the virtual machine, and memory value.

  • Click Build Virtual Machine to successfully create the virtual machine. You can now connect to it and access data.

    Connect and access the created virtual machine

    Once you build a virtual machine you can click against the virtual machine and download the RDP connection file to connect.
